#2e3610 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2e3610 is composed of 18% red, 21.2%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 70.4% yellow and 78.8% black. It has a hue angle of 72.6 degrees, a saturation of 54.3% and a lightness of 13.7%. #2e3610 color hex could be obtained by blending #5c6c20 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#2e3610
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070903 is the darkest color, while #fcfd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2e3610
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#232323 is the less saturated color, while #364303 is the most saturated one.
